Sillyman University is another learning institution located in the Mishabu region of the Philippines. Like the oldest university in Manila, St. Thomas University, Silliman University is the oldest American academic school in the Philippines, established in 1901 by the Presbyterian Council of Foreign Missions. The American missionary named it after the famous New York philanthropist Dr. Horace Brinsmad Silliman (Hillice Brinsmade Silliman). The campus is not only full of hardworking students, but also full of lush green trees with beautiful sea views. This is a famous and respected educational institution in the Philippines. It offers courses in almost every discipline. Be sure to visit this well-preserved school, which was founded by the first Americans. It is located on campus, facing the Richar Avenue and the sea. It is a model of colonial architecture.
